Synopsis

CLEAT is an elite task force of specialized police officers with the mandate of protecting celebrities from themselves, intervening in their lives when Hollywood corrupts them, minimizing their scandals and crimes to safeguard Canada's reputation, and cracking down on foreign celebrities who wreak havoc in Canada.

With a crack team of officers with failed entertainment backgrounds (acting, modelling, sports and Canadian Idol disasters), celebrity informants and a once-famous Captain now bent on keeping a tight leash on the stars, CLEAT is an edgy, awkwardly funny, celebrity-cameo friendly, no holds-barred hip-slapper, 'Extras' meets 'Brooklyn Nine-Nine' with a sprinkle of Californication.
